1848 THE CONGREGATIONAL VISITOR. History of Sabbath Schools and Westward Expansion. Ephemera crystallized articulation of what idealVery nicely preserved volume largely dedicated to Sabbath Schools, equipping instructors, pleading the urgency of sending Sabbath School teachers as part of the Westward Expansion, giving the historical effectiveness of the Schools, etc., Very nice inscription on from the Martha Washington Social Library Association. Various Authors. The Congregational Visitor. Vol. 5. 1848. 288pp. A very good copy, bound in cloth, generally solid, with generally
